Lions receiver Calvin Johnson believes that rookie quarterback Matthew Stafford is already way ahead of the learning curve. "He's definitely learning play by play," Johnson told the Detroit Free Press. "Every time he throws me the ball, he's learning the places where he can put it that I can get to it." Johnson, one of the NFL's best receivers, has endured a carousel at the quarterback position in Detroit. "He makes throws you don't see an everyday rookie make," Johnson said. "He's way ahead of the curve. ... It seems like the kid came in here and he knew what he was doing right off the bat."
